Why Is It Important to Use Scaffolding?

 

Scaffolding NH helps in many ways. Here are a few:

 

                   1. It safeguards people, buildings andother property in close proximity to the construction site.

T his includes passersby, vehicles and structures located nearby.

 

  1. Itminimizes risk of injury to workers involved in the building project.

In acting as effective safety solutions, scaffoldsensure that the people working on the site are not exposed to unnecessary risk.

 

  1. It limits the movement of contaminants.

The construction site is a source of numerous contaminants, including chemicals, liquid compounds, dust and other airborne particles. Containment scaffolds prevent these compounds from flowing to the outside, thus protecting people, any animals in the vicinity, and the environment.

 

  1. It eliminates disruptions in day-to-day activities.

Scaffolding experts use a range of containment materials to minimize or completely eliminate disruptions to normal activity in the surrounding areas. These include noise and the visual distraction that the site would cause if left open all around.

 

  1. It helps the constructionprocess move along steadily.

Proper scaffoldinghelps things move quickly in any building project.

 

  1. It enables limitless opportunities for building.

Because of the safety nets it provides in each stage of the construction process, scaffolding helps actualize architectural projects that seek to construct very tall buildings or buildings in unusual shapes. All the massive buildings we admire wouldn’t exist were it not for scaffolding.
